Historical & Cultural Background
Aaryn is a modern variation of the name Erin, which has Irish origins. It has gained popularity in English-speaking countries, particularly in the late 20th century. The name is often associated with a sense of strength and enlightenment. Its unique spelling sets it apart from more traditional names.

U.S. Historical Usage
The name Aaryn was first seen in the United States in 1973. Aaryn has ranked as high as #1325 nationally, which occurred in 2014, and has been most popular in Texas, California, Georgia, North Carolina, and Virginia. In the past 5 years the name Aaryn has been trending down compared to the previous 5 years.
